Treatment of Ocular Demodex Infestation With Topical Ivermectin Cream 1%

Summary
Patients with Demodex infestation of the eyelids will have the sleeves from both eyes cleaned
off with microblepharoexfoliation. Afterwards, one eye will be randomly selected for
treatment with topical ivermectin 1% cream. The treatment will be repeated on that eye 2
weeks later. Afterwards, the patients will present monthly for photographs of the eyelashes.
The photographs will be reviewed by an ophthalmologist outside of our institution who will be
blind to which eye was treated and independently grade the amount of sleeves in each eye. The
follow-up will be for 6 months after the second treatment.
